The 3260 postcode, which includes Weerite, Bookaar, Bostocks Creek, Bungador, Camperdown, Carpendeit, Chocolyn, Gnotuk, Kariah, Koallah, Leslie Manor, Pomborneit, Pomborneit North, Skibo, South Purrumbete, Stonyford, Tandarook and Tesbury, has 2,230 households. Of these, 607 homes — or 27.2% — have installed rooftop solar panels, reflecting the community's growing move toward renewable energy. With more Weerite residents looking to reduce their reliance on the electricity grid, many are now turning to solar battery storage as the next step. Solar batteries help homeowners lower energy bills, increase energy independence, and improve long-term sustainability.
According to daily average sunshine data from the nearest weather station at Camperdown (post Office), households in this community receive approximately 4.2 kWh of sunlight per day. Across 3260, rooftop solar systems collectively generate approximately 6,399,000 kWh of clean energy each year, based on an average system size of 8.1 kW. At current electricity rates, that's equivalent to around $1,919,700 of clean energy at grid electricity costs annually.
Solar Battery energy storage is growing just as rapidly, with 12 battery systems now installed across 3260. Together, these systems provide 160 kWh of stored energy capacity, with the average household storing around 13.4 kWh. This means local solar households can typically power their homes for 5.3 hours each night using clean energy they generated themselves during the day.
So instead of sending excess solar energy back to the grid for lower returns, Weerite homeowners are now storing and using their own clean power around the clock. This smart approach not only reduces reliance on expensive coal-generated electricity from the grid, it protects against blackouts, improves sustainability, and maximises their solar investment and long-term financial returns.

Interest in solar batteries VIC and Virtual Power Plants (VPPs) is on the rise in Weerite, and for good reason. Thanks to the Australian Federal Government’s solar batteries rebate VIC, eligible homeowners can save up to 30% off the cost of installing a battery, with typical 11.5–13.5 kWh systems attracting rebates of $3,400–$4,000. This can halve the payback period to as little as 3–4 years. VPP participation can boost savings even further, letting you earn credits by sharing stored power with the community grid – a win for both your wallet and local energy resilience.
